XTS trong mã hóa: Ứng dụng và lợi ích

essays-star4(216 phiếu bầu)

Trong thế giới số hóa ngày nay, việc bảo vệ dữ liệu trở nên cực kỳ quan trọng. Mã hóa là một trong những phương pháp phổ biến nhất để bảo vệ dữ liệu, và XTS là một chế độ hoạt động của mã hóa khối đang được sử dụng rộng rãi.

<h2 style="font-weight: bold; margin: 12px 0;">XTS trong mã hóa là gì?</h2>XTS là một chế độ hoạt động của mã hóa khối, được sử dụng rộng rãi trong các ứng dụng mã hóa đĩa. XTS, viết tắt của XEX-based Tweaked CodeBook mode (with ciphertext stealing), là một phương pháp mã hóa dữ liệu cung cấp khả năng bảo vệ dữ liệu trước các cuộc tấn công như tấn công phân tích lưu lượng mạng.

<h2 style="font-weight: bold; margin: 12px 0;">Ứng dụng của XTS trong mã hóa là gì?</h2>XTS được sử dụng rộng rãi trong các ứng dụng mã hóa đĩa, bao gồm cả ổ đĩa cứng và ổ đĩa flash. Nó cung cấp một cách hiệu quả để mã hóa dữ liệu trên các thiết bị lưu trữ, giúp bảo vệ dữ liệu khỏi việc truy cập trái phép.

<h2 style="font-weight: bold; margin: 12px 0;">Lợi ích của việc sử dụng XTS trong mã hóa là gì?</h2>Việc sử dụng XTS trong mã hóa mang lại nhiều lợi ích. Đầu tiên, nó cung cấp một cấp độ bảo mật cao, giúp bảo vệ dữ liệu khỏi các cuộc tấn công. Thứ hai, nó cho phép mã hóa dữ liệu mà không cần tăng kích thước của dữ liệu, điều này rất quan trọng đối với các thiết bị lưu trữ có dung lượng hạn chế. Cuối cùng, XTS cung cấp khả năng bảo vệ dữ liệu trước các cuộc tấn công như tấn công phân tích lưu lượng mạng.

<h2 style="font-weight: bold; margin: 12px 0;">XTS có an toàn không?</h2>XTS được coi là một trong những chế độ hoạt động an toàn nhất của mã hóa khối. Nó cung cấp một cấp độ bảo mật cao và khả năng chống lại nhiều loại cuộc tấn công. Tuy nhiên, như mọi phương pháp mã hóa, XTS cũng không hoàn toàn không thể bị phá vỡ. Nó vẫn có thể bị tấn công nếu khóa mã hóa bị lộ hoặc nếu kẻ tấn công có đủ thời gian và tài nguyên.

<h2 style="font-weight: bold; margin: 12px 0;">XTS so với các chế độ hoạt động khác của mã hóa khối có gì khác biệt?</h2>XTS có một số đặc điểm khác biệt so với các chế độ hoạt động khác của mã hóa khối. Đầu tiên, nó sử dụng một hàm "tweak" để thay đổi khóa mã hóa cho mỗi khối dữ liệu, điều này giúp tăng cường bảo mật. Thứ hai, XTS cho phép mã hóa dữ liệu mà không cần tăng kích thước của dữ liệu, điều này rất quan trọng đối với các thiết bị lưu trữ có dung lượng hạn chế. Cuối cùng, XTS cung cấp khả năng bảo vệ dữ liệu trước các cuộc tấn công như tấn công phân tích lưu lượng mạng.

XTS là một công cụ mạnh mẽ trong việc bảo vệ dữ liệu. Nó cung cấp một cấp độ bảo mật cao, khả năng chống lại nhiều loại cuộc tấn công và khả năng mã hóa dữ liệu mà không cần tăng kích thước của dữ liệu. Tuy nhiên, như mọi phương pháp mã hóa, XTS cũng không hoàn toàn không thể bị phá vỡ. Do đó, việc sử dụng XTS nên đi kèm với các biện pháp bảo mật khác để đảm bảo an toàn tối đa cho dữ liệu.